Understanding the Mudjacking Process

Addressing sunken or uneven concrete surfaces commonly requires the mudjacking process, a proven and efficient technique for leveling. This method entails drilling small holes into the affected concrete slab and injecting a mixture of water, soil, and cement beneath it. As the material is pumped in, it fills voids and raises the slab to its original position. Mudjacking is valued for its economical nature and swiftness, permitting fast repairs with minimal interference. It is especially beneficial for patios, driveways, and sidewalks, where uneven surfaces may create safety risks. By reestablishing structural integrity and enhancing appearance, mudjacking not only improves the performance of concrete surfaces but also extends their longevity, making it a sought-after option among homeowners and contractors alike.

Polyurethane Injection Advantages

Polyurethane injection emerges as a contemporary method for correcting irregular concrete slabs, offering numerous advantages over traditional methods like mudjacking. This method works by injecting a light polyurethane foam material below the concrete, which expands and fills voids, successfully raising the slab. A key advantage is its quick curing time, frequently enabling use in a matter of hours, reducing downtime. Moreover, polyurethane foam demonstrates excellent water resistance, lowering the chances of subsequent settling. The injection process is also less invasive, needing only smaller entry points and causing reduced impact on the surrounding surface. Additionally, the lightweight composition of polyurethane avoids placing extra pressure on the underlying soil, guaranteeing durable outcomes for a range of concrete structures. In summary, polyurethane injection delivers an efficient, reliable, and effective solution for concrete leveling.

Self-Leveling Compound Installation

Achieving a flat, even surface with a self-leveling compound requires careful preparation and application techniques. Initially, the underlying concrete surface must be cleaned thoroughly to remove debris, dust, and grease. Upon verifying the surface is dry, any cracks should be sealed and primed to encourage stronger adhesion. Preparing the self-leveling compound according to the manufacturer's specifications is important; proper consistency guarantees ideal flow. Dispensing the compound in a continuous manner and using a gauge rake can help apply it evenly. It is important to work quickly, as self-leveling compounds set rapidly. In conclusion, permitting the compound to cure fully before applying any flooring material provides a sturdy and perfect foundation.

How to Know When Concrete Leveling Becomes Necessary

Uneven concrete areas can appear in a number of ways, suggesting that repairs and leveling are necessary. Property owners might observe cracks, voids, or upheaval in their driveways, walkways, or patios. Water accumulating in particular areas rather than flowing away serves as another sign of a deeper issue. Furthermore, raised concrete slabs can create dangerous trip hazards, presenting safety concerns for both residents and visitors.

In basement or garage areas, uneven flooring can cause issues with installed fixtures or appliances, compromising their functionality. Checking for visible indicators, such as sloped surfaces or separation between slabs, is essential. Furthermore, doors and windows might stick or not close correctly because of foundation movement.

Regular assessments of indoor and outdoor concrete can assist in identifying these indicators early. Resolving these concerns in a timely fashion ensures lasting structural stability and enhances the complete visual appeal and safety of the property.

Categories Of Leveling Methods

When selecting a leveling approach, it is important to evaluate the specific needs of the task, as numerous approaches offer unique benefits and drawbacks. Popular techniques include mudjacking, where a cement mixture is pumped under slabs to raise them, and foam injection, which provides a lightweight, quick-curing solution. Furthermore, grinding removes elevated areas to establish an even surface, while screeding is employed on fresh concrete to achieve a uniform finish. Each method varies in cost, time efficiency, and suitability for different types of surface issues. At the end of the day, choosing the ideal leveling approach copyrights on factors like the extent of the problem, environmental conditions, and the desired longevity of the repair, guaranteeing the best results for any concrete leveling application.

Essential Factors To Think About

Selecting the right leveling approach demands a detailed evaluation of several key factors that affect the success of the restoration. First, the extent of the damage is crucial; minimal shifting may require only surface treatments, while major displacement may demand more comprehensive approaches. Additionally, soil conditions are a major factor; loose or reactive soils can affect the selection of technique. Moreover, budget constraints must be factored in, as alternative approaches vary in cost and longevity. Additionally, the planned purpose of the area should guide the choice, as heavy loads may necessitate more robust methods. Finally, the local climate conditions can influence material choice and durability, making it critical to evaluate local conditions before beginning the work.

Commonly Asked Questions

How Long Does Concrete Leveling Typically Take?

Concrete leveling generally requires anywhere from a few hours to a full day, depending on the area size and the method used. Weather conditions and curing time can also influence how long the entire process takes.

Is Concrete Leveling Something You Can DIY?

Concrete leveling can be a DIY project, but it requires careful planning and proper tools. Individuals who have a background in home improvement may handle the task with success, while those new to the task may want to consider expert guidance to guarantee the best results.

What Are the Expenses Involved in Concrete Leveling?

Costs for concrete leveling typically range from $2 to $10 per square foot, depending on factors like the extent of the damage, materials utilized, and area labor rates. Additional expenses may arise from preparatory work or equipment rental.

Is It Safe to Walk on Leveled Concrete Right Away?

Treading on leveled concrete right away is typically not advised. It generally needs a curing period, allowing the material to set properly. This promotes strength and reduces the risk of harm, with timelines varying based on the exact leveling approach employed.

What Materials Are Utilized in Concrete Leveling?

Concrete floor leveling commonly requires materials including polymer-modified cement, self-leveling compounds, and adhesion-enhancing additives. Implements including hand trowels and floats may also be used to ensure a flat, consistent surface during the application.
